There is no such thing as waterproof or waterproof Oxford cloth itself. Oxford cloth is also called Oxford spun. It uses polyester polyester-cotton blended yarn and cotton yarn to interweave, and adopts flat weft or square weave. It has the characteristics of easy washing and quick drying, soft hand feeling, good moisture absorption and comfortable wearing. Oxford spinning is a fabric weaving method, which refers to the overlapping order of horizontal and vertical cotton yarns when weaving.
Oxford cloth itself is not waterproof, and waterproofing agent is added in the post-treatment process to achieve the waterproof effect. Different uses have different waterproof effects.
